Rubies are for str. You'd need emeralds for that.

And I'm not entirely sure they'd be worth that much, either, or at least they're going to be harder to sell that high. Thing is that monks definitely won't buy them. You can find really nice monk pants with the resist of your choice for decently cheap, or at least way way way cheaper than that. My own pats have 60 dex, 200+ vit, 2 open sockets, and 56 lightning resist. So, honestly someone like me would never make the switch, especially since All Res seems to command a premium. That means your only hope is from DHs. You very well could get a DH to buy it, I'm just not sure at that much. I would think a DH would pay a good amount (again, because all resist commands a premium), but maybe only like 20 million.

The other thing is that I think a lot of builds tend to search for large vit on pants. That's one of the spots that's really easy to get a large vit roll, so they make up the main stat on everything else where it's easier to get a large roll on that. Gloves and boots for instance to up to like 300.

Are Demon Hunters the only class that can skip resistence gear? I thought Wizards did too but I noticed all the top wiz have 900+ resist. I freaking hate resist.

I personally think DHs are the ones that have to focus most on having resists. What I mean by that is every other class has some way of upping their resists even higher than they actually are, whereas DHs don't have anything. Monks have One With Everything, Barbs have a warcry, and Wizards and WDs have the fact that their main stat is INT to inflate their resistances. Most wizards I know have the highest unbuffed resists of any class.
